Xander Edwards is a Record-Setting Running Back in Florida

October 17, 2025
Xander Edwards broke a Florida state record with 8 touchdowns and 517 rushing yards in a single game, surpassing Derrick Henry's mark.

Eight touchdowns. 517 rushing yards. One game.

Xander Edwards broke a Florida high school record previously held by Derrick Henry. The Bolles School running back has NFL bloodlines—his father Marc won a Super Bowl—and now has Syracuse, Florida, Florida State, Miami, and Notre Dame extending offers.

The performance announced his arrival on the national stage.
